- 2000 Placed first on Admission exam at Medical School of “Federico II” University in Naples (Italy)
- 2006 Graduated with Honours in Medicine and Surgery at “Federico II” University in Naples (Italy), highest grade level (110/110 cum laude)
- 2007 License to practice Medicine and Surgery at “Federico II” University in Naples (Italy), highest grade level.
- 2011 Fellowship at the Department of Minimal Invasive Surgery under the guidance of Prof. Riccardo Rosati. IRCCS Humanitas Cancer Center. Milan, Italy
- 2011 School of Italian Association of Hospital Surgeons on Esophageal Surgery
- 2012 School of Italian Association of Hospital Surgeons on Laparoscopic and Minimally Invasive Surgery
- 2013 Board Certified in General Surgery at “Federico II” University in Naples (Italy), highest grade level (110/110 cum laude)
- 2013 Observership at The Royal Surrey County Hospital (Regional Oesophago-Gastric Unit), Guildford Surrey, UK, under the guidance of Dr Mr Shaun R Preston, Upper GI and Laparoscopic Surgeon
- 2015 Advanced Laparoscopic Course of Esophago-Gastric Surgery; AIMS Academy.
- 2016 PhD in Surgical Science and Advanced Techniques at “Federico II” University in Naples (Italy)
- 2017 Advanced Laparoscopic Course for Colerectal Surgery; AIMS Academy.
- 2017 CRSA European Chapter Colorectal Courses at the ACOI’s Special School of Mini Invasive Robotic Surgery.
- 2017 Visiting Professor at Misericordia Hospital, Grosseto, Italy, under the guidance of Dr PP Bianchi, General Surgery and Robotic School director
- 2017 CRSA European Chapter Upper GI/Pancreatic at the School of Mini Invasive Robotic Surgery.
